Lesson 3: Creating Content That Converts

Content is the engine that drives your online presence. Whether it’s blog posts, videos, social media updates, or emails, creating content that actually converts visitors into followers, leads, and customers is critical.

Here’s how to approach content strategically:

  • Know Your Audience: Before you create anything, understand who you are speaking to. What problems are they facing? What solutions are they seeking?
  • Focus on Value: Every piece of content should teach, inform, or solve a problem. Value builds trust, and trust converts.
  • Clarity Over Complexity: Avoid jargon or overcomplicated explanations. Clear, actionable content performs better.
  • Consistency is Key: Regular posting keeps your audience engaged and helps build momentum over time.
  • Call-to-Action (CTA): Every piece of content should guide your audience to the next step — subscribing, downloading, or purchasing.
  • Repurpose Smartly: Turn blog posts into emails, videos into social media snippets, and guides into checklists. More exposure with less effort.

Remember, content that converts isn’t about being flashy. It’s about **solving problems consistently** and **helping your audience achieve results**.

Example strategies that work for beginners:

  • Write “how-to” posts that show step-by-step solutions.
  • Create lists of tips or tools your audience can use immediately.
  • Share real-life case studies or your own experiences to build credibility.
  • Use storytelling to make your lessons relatable and memorable.

With a strong content plan, you’ll not only attract visitors, but you’ll also nurture them into loyal followers and customers — the lifeblood of any online business.

Create Your First Mini Offer

Lesson 3 is all about taking action and turning your ideas into a tangible offer. Today, you’ll learn how to craft a small, valuable product or service that your audience can purchase quickly — without overcomplicating things.

Step 1: Identify a Pain Point

Think about a problem your audience faces. The more specific, the better:

  • Saving time or avoiding mistakes
  • Learning a specific skill quickly
  • Automating a repetitive task
  • Getting guidance without confusion

Pro Exercise: Write down 3 problems your audience faces right now and prioritize the easiest to solve.

Step 2: Package a Simple Solution

Create a mini product that delivers immediate value. Examples:

  • One-page checklist or cheat sheet
  • Mini-course or video tutorial
  • Template, spreadsheet, or guide
  • Quick email sequence or resource list

Pro Tip: Keep it under 30 minutes of content — quick wins sell better.

Step 3: Write a Persuasive Message

Use clear, compelling language to show how your offer solves a problem. Include:

  • Benefit-focused headline
  • Concise explanation of the solution
  • Simple call-to-action: “Buy now,” “Download instantly,” or “Get access”

Pro Exercise: Draft a 2–3 sentence offer description today. Ask ChatGPT for 3 alternative versions and pick the best.

Step 4: Deliver Instantly

Automation is key. Options include:

  • Email automation (AWeber, MailerLite, or ConvertKit)
  • Instant download via link (Google Drive, Dropbox, or your website)
  • Use a mini-landing page to host content safely

Pro Tip: Test the delivery yourself first to ensure a seamless experience.

Step 5: Test and Iterate

  • Share your offer with a small group first
  • Collect feedback on clarity, value, and usability
  • Adjust your content, messaging, or delivery to improve results
  • Track which versions convert better

Pro Exercise: Make one change per week to improve your mini offer — measure the impact each time.

Extra Tips

  • Keep the offer small — people prefer quick wins
  • Focus on benefits, not just features
  • Use automation tools to save time
  • Follow up with bonus tips or resources to increase satisfaction
  • Repurpose your mini offer content into social posts or email snippets

Transform Your Ideas into Mini Offers

Lesson 3 walks you through taking a simple idea and turning it into a small, sellable digital offer. This helps you start generating revenue faster while building confidence and skills.

Step 1: Choose Your Idea

Select a simple idea you can teach, demonstrate, or package digitally in a mini course, PDF, checklist, or template.

Step 2: Package Your Offer

Create a small, digestible product. Keep it under 20 minutes, 10 pages, or 5 actionable steps.

Step 3: Set Your Price

Start with a low entry price (e.g., $7–$27). Your goal is experience and early revenue, not maximum profit.

Step 4: Promote Your Offer

Share it with your audience, friends, or test paid ads to get your first sales. Collect feedback for improvements.

Creating and selling online courses is a fantastic way to share your knowledge while earning a significant income. This booming industry allows you to package your expertise into a product that helps others achieve their goals.


Why Online Courses?

  1. High Demand: People seek convenient ways to learn new skills or solve problems.
  2. Scalability: Sell a course once and earn from it repeatedly.
  3. Flexibility: Create courses on your schedule and cater to a global audience.
    .

Step 1: Identify Your Expertise

  1. What are you good at? Think of skills, hobbies, or professional experience you can teach.
  2. What’s in demand? Research what people want to learn using platforms like Udemy or Skillshare.
    .

Step 2: Define Your Target Audience

  • Who will benefit most from your course?
  • What problems do they want to solve?
  • Where do they currently seek solutions?

Create a clear profile of your ideal student.

Step 3: Structure Your Course

  1. Break it into modules: Organize your course into logical steps or topics.
  2. Keep lessons short: Aim for 5–10 minutes per lesson to maintain engagement.
  3. Include resources: Add worksheets, quizzes, or templates to enhance learning.

    .

Step 4: Choose Your Tools

  1. Course Platforms: Use platforms like Teachable, Thinkific, or Kajabi to host and sell your course.
  2. Content Creation Tools: Use PowerPoint or Canva for slides, and Zoom or Loom for video recordings.
  3. Editing Software: Enhance videos with tools like Camtasia or iMovie.

Step 5: Create High-Quality Content

  • Video Lessons: Record yourself teaching or create slide presentations with voiceovers.
  • Interactive Elements: Add assignments, discussion boards, or live Q&A sessions.
  • Polished Delivery: Use good lighting, clear audio, and professional visuals
    .

Step 6: Launch Your Course

  1. Pre-Sell Your Course: Gauge interest by offering an early-bird discount.
  2. Build Hype: Share behind-the-scenes content or testimonials on social media.
  3. Choose a Pricing Model: Offer one-time payments or subscriptions.
    .

Step 7: Market Your Course

  1. Email Marketing: Send targeted campaigns to your mailing list.
  2. Social Media Ads: Invest in Facebook or Instagram ads to reach your audience.
  3. Collaborate: Partner with influencers or bloggers in your niche.
    .

Earning Potential

Successful course creators can earn between $1,000 and $100,000+ per course launch, depending on their audience size and marketing efforts.

Pro Tip

Focus on outcomes. Make sure your course promises (and delivers) clear, actionable results for students.
